Introduction
Dans le paysage en constante évolution du développement Web, maintenir un code propre et lisible n'est pas seulement une bonne pratique ; c'est une nécessité. À mesure que les projets deviennent plus complexes, le besoin d'un code bien structuré devient encore plus critique. L'un des outils les plus efficaces à la disposition d'un développeur est le HTML Beautifier. Cet article se penche en profondeur sur le concept des HTML Beautifiers, en explorant leurs avantages, leur utilisation et les meilleurs outils disponibles pour vous aider à améliorer votre expérience de codage.
Qu'est-ce qu'un embellisseur HTML ?
Un HTML Beautifier est un outil spécialisé qui formate le code HTML pour améliorer sa lisibilité et sa structure. Il organise votre code en appliquant une indentation, un espacement et des sauts de ligne cohérents, le rendant ainsi visuellement attrayant et plus facile à suivre. Que vous soyez un développeur expérimenté ou que vous débutiez, l'utilisation d'un HTML Beautifier peut vous aider à écrire un code plus propre et conforme aux normes du secteur.
L'importance d'un code propre
Un code propre est la base de tout projet logiciel réussi. Voici pourquoi c'est important :
- Collaboration : lorsque plusieurs développeurs travaillent sur un même projet, un code propre et organisé garantit que tout le monde peut facilement comprendre et contribuer sans confusion.
- Maintenance : Au fil du temps, les projets évoluent et nécessitent des mises à jour. Un code propre permet des modifications et un débogage plus faciles, réduisant ainsi le risque d'introduire de nouvelles erreurs.
- Évolutivité : à mesure que votre projet se développe, un code bien structuré vous permet de le faire évoluer plus efficacement. De nouvelles fonctionnalités peuvent être ajoutées sans remanier les structures existantes.
- Lisibilité : le code lisible est plus facile à réviser, ce qui conduit à une meilleure assurance qualité et à des applications plus robustes.
- Réduction de la dette technique : investir du temps dans l’écriture de code propre minimise les complications futures et la dette technique, ce qui permet d’économiser du temps et des ressources.
Avantages de l'utilisation d'un embellisseur HTML
L'intégration d'un embellisseur HTML dans votre flux de travail de codage peut apporter plusieurs avantages :
- Lisibilité améliorée : le code embelli est organisé visuellement, ce qui permet aux développeurs de scanner et de comprendre rapidement la structure, ce qui est particulièrement bénéfique pour les documents HTML complexes.
- Formatage cohérent : un embellisseur HTML garantit que votre code suit un style uniforme, minimisant ainsi les variations qui peuvent entraîner une confusion lors de la collaboration en équipe.
- Détection d'erreurs : en organisant le code, les embellisseurs aident à mettre en évidence les erreurs ou les incohérences, telles que les balises non fermées ou les attributs mal placés, qui pourraient être négligés dans le code non formaté.
- Gain de temps : le formatage automatisé peut faire gagner un temps considérable par rapport à l'effort manuel requis pour ranger le code, permettant aux développeurs de se concentrer sur la fonctionnalité plutôt que sur l'esthétique.
- Meilleure maintenance : un code bien structuré est plus facile à mettre à jour et à maintenir, ce qui est essentiel pour le succès à long terme du projet.
- Productivité accrue : en passant moins de temps à déchiffrer du code compliqué, les développeurs peuvent consacrer plus d’énergie à l’écriture de nouvelles fonctionnalités et à l’amélioration de celles existantes.
Comment utiliser un embellisseur HTML
Il est simple de commencer à utiliser un embellisseur HTML. Suivez ces étapes pour embellir votre code :
- Sélectionnez un outil : Choisissez un outil d'embellissement HTML en ligne ou téléchargez l'application logicielle qui correspond le mieux à vos besoins. Certains outils populaires seront abordés plus loin dans cet article.
- Collez votre code : copiez votre code HTML non formaté et collez-le dans la zone de saisie de l'outil d'embellissement. La plupart des outils prennent en charge une variété d'extraits de code.
- Personnaliser les paramètres : de nombreux embellisseurs HTML proposent des options de personnalisation, telles que la taille de l'indentation (par exemple, 2 espaces, 4 espaces) et les sauts de ligne. Ajustez ces paramètres en fonction de vos préférences ou des normes de votre projet.
- Embellir : cliquez sur le bouton « Embellir » ou sur une action équivalente dans l'outil pour transformer votre code dans un format plus lisible.
- Révision et copie : une fois le processus d’embellissement terminé, révisez le code formaté pour y apporter des modifications supplémentaires, puis copiez le code nouvellement formaté pour l’utiliser dans vos projets.
Outils populaires d'embellissement HTML
Il existe plusieurs outils HTML Beautifier disponibles, chacun doté de fonctionnalités et de caractéristiques uniques. Voici quelques options populaires :
- FreeFormatter : Cet outil en ligne offre une interface simple pour embellir le code HTML, avec des options de personnalisation.
- Code Beautify : un outil polyvalent qui prend en charge plusieurs langages de programmation, il offre une gamme d'options de formatage.
- Formateur HTML : Connu pour sa simplicité, cet outil permet un embellissement rapide avec un minimum de tracas.
- Outils d'embellissement : Cet outil offre des fonctionnalités supplémentaires, notamment des options de validation HTML et de minification.
- PrettyDiff : un outil puissant qui non seulement embellit le HTML mais prend également en charge la comparaison et la différenciation des révisions de code.
Intégration d'embellisseurs HTML dans votre flux de travail
Pour maximiser les avantages des embellisseurs HTML, pensez à les intégrer à vos pratiques de codage habituelles :
- Hooks de pré-validation : si vous utilisez des systèmes de contrôle de version comme Git, pensez à configurer des hooks de pré-validation qui embellissent automatiquement votre code HTML avant qu'il ne soit validé. Cela garantit que tout le code de votre référentiel reste propre.
- Plugins IDE : de nombreux environnements de développement intégrés (IDE) proposent des plug-ins ou des extensions qui peuvent formater automatiquement le code HTML au fur et à mesure que vous l'écrivez. Découvrez les plug-ins disponibles pour des outils tels que Visual Studio Code, Sublime Text ou Atom.
- Normes d'équipe : établissez des normes de codage pour votre équipe qui incluent des pratiques d'embellissement. Encouragez les membres de l'équipe à utiliser le même embellisseur HTML pour maintenir la cohérence dans l'ensemble de la base de code.
- Examens réguliers du code : implémentez des examens réguliers du code qui incluent des contrôles de lisibilité et de structure du code. Utilisez des embellisseurs HTML lors de ces examens pour vous assurer que tout le code répond aux normes de votre équipe.
Erreurs courantes à éviter
Bien que l’utilisation d’un embellisseur HTML puisse améliorer considérablement votre code, il existe des pièges courants à éviter :
- Dépendance excessive : ne vous fiez pas uniquement aux embellisseurs pour la qualité du code. Vérifiez toujours votre code manuellement pour vous assurer que la logique et les fonctionnalités sont correctes.
- Ignorer la personnalisation : tous les projets ne sont pas identiques. Personnalisez toujours les paramètres d'embellissement en fonction des exigences de votre projet et des normes de l'équipe.
- Négliger la documentation : n'oubliez pas que les embellisseurs se concentrent sur la structure du code, mais ils ne remplacent pas le besoin d'une documentation appropriée. Commentez soigneusement votre code pour expliquer les sections complexes.
Conclusion
Libérer la puissance d'un HTML Beautifier peut améliorer considérablement votre flux de travail de développement et améliorer la qualité du code. En transformant votre code en un format plus propre et plus lisible, vous améliorez non seulement votre efficacité, mais vous facilitez également la collaboration avec votre équipe et réduisez les problèmes de maintenance à l'avenir. Bénéficiez dès aujourd'hui des avantages d'un HTML Beautifier et faites passer vos pratiques de codage au niveau supérieur. Avec les bons outils et les bonnes pratiques, l'écriture d'un code magnifique peut faire partie intégrante de votre processus de développement, ouvrant la voie à des projets réussis et à une expérience de codage plus agréable !
Laisser un commentaire
Ce site est protégé par hCaptcha, et la Politique de confidentialité et les Conditions de service de hCaptcha s’appliquent.